1. Start with the Infrared Sauna:
- Duration: Begin by spending 10-15 minutes in the infrared sauna. The gentle heat from the sauna penetrates deep into the body, increasing your core temperature and causing vasodilation (the widening of blood vessels), which promotes increased blood flow and relaxation.
- Benefits: This initial heat exposure helps loosen muscles, encourages sweating to aid in detoxification, and prepares your body for the cold plunge by elevating circulation and enhancing the overall therapeutic effect.
2. Shower Before Entering the Cold Plunge:
- Why It’s Important: It’s essential to take a quick shower before entering the Cold Plunge to remove any sweat, oils, or impurities from your skin. This step helps maintain the cleanliness of the cold plunge and enhances your experience.
3. Transition Immediately to the Best Cold Plunge Therapy in La Jolla:
- Duration: After your sauna session and shower, immediately transition to the Cold Plunge La Jolla and immerse your body for 3-5 minutes. The cold water will constrict your blood vessels (vasoconstriction), which helps reduce inflammation, soothe sore muscles, and flush out metabolic waste.
- Benefits: The cold plunge provides deep tissue recovery, reduces inflammation, and enhances the removal of toxins from your body, further promoting recovery and rejuvenation.
4. Repeat the Cycle:
- Cycles: For maximum benefit, repeat the sauna, shower, and cold plunge cycle 2-3 times. Alternating between heat and cold therapy enhances the circulatory benefits and intensifies the recovery process.
- Considerations: Always listen to your body. If you start to feel too cold or too hot, take a break. The proximity of the sauna and cold plunge at LIVKRAFT makes it easy to move between them quickly, ensuring the most effective contrast therapy experience.
5. Finish with a Relaxation Period:
- Relax: After completing your cycles, allow your body to return to a normal state. Spend some time in a neutral temperature environment or in a comfortable resting area within the room. Light stretching or hydration can further help your body stabilize and recover.
